Fidelity: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Solana at Historical Lows in Net Unrealized Gains
Fidelity Digital Assets has released its Q3 Signal Report, which reveals that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), and Solana (SOL) are all at historical lows in terms of net unrealized gains and losses. According to the report, the weighted net unrealized profit and loss (NUPL) is -0.01, indicating a bearish market sentiment.
BTC is the only asset with a positive unrealized profit, approximately 10% above its cost basis, with an unrealized profit of about $108 billion. In contrast, ETH and SOL are approximately 30% and 41% below their cost bases, with unrealized losses of about $87 billion and $29 billion, respectively.
The report states that the current NUPL readings for the three assets correspond to one-year median returns of 53%, 70%, and 542%, respectively. However, it's worth noting that the reliability of these samples decreases sequentially, particularly for Solana (SOL), which has only occurred 21 times in history.
On a fundamental level, stablecoin transfers have reached new highs for both ETH and SOL, exceeding $20 trillion and $2.6 trillion over the past 12 months. However, network fee revenue continues to decline.
